What things are recycled (used over and over again) during photosynthesis and respiration

Biology
2 answers:
Flauer [41]3 years ago
8 0
Carbon dioxide

<span>There are several starting ingredients that are required for starting the process of photosynthesis. The most important are sunlight, water, carbon dioxide and certain minerals. Sunlight helps in building up the optimum temperature that is required to start the process of photosynthesis. Water is an important raw material that helps to absorb the carbon dioxide from the air. It also directly influences the opening and closing of the stomata. Carbon dioxide on the other hand is one of the most important raw material that helps to make glucose via the process of photosynthesis.</span>

A client has a positive elisa test. On examination, the client is found to have fever, weight loss, and candida infections. The
ratelena [41]

The answer is 200 cells per microliter

Fever, weight loss, and candida infections are symptoms of immunodeficiency. These symptoms only appear if the level of CD4+ count is below normal, resulting in disruption of the immune cells work. The threshold level of CD4 count to cause immunodeficiency symptoms is 200 cells per microliter.
